Daylight seems to be getting diminished for the Rajasthan Royals skipper Sanju Samson as he made an early exit for the second consecutive time in three matches he played so far.

The captain came into bat at 30/1 while chasing a target of 188. The team really needed to gain some momentum and put some pressure back on the CSK  bowlers but on the last ball of Sam Curran’s over Sanju hit the ball straight to Dwayne Bravo and got dismissed at 1 for 5 balls

In his last match against the Delhi Capitals, he had a similar story where got dismissed in the initial stage of the innings.

The RR skipper scored a ton in the first match against the Punjab Kings but has struggled to find a way out in his last two matches, one being today. After that century he looked in a very destructive form and good touch but he has been unable to live up to the expectations of his team and fans with his poor form in his last 2 innings.

The skipper must find ways to anchor the innings in the upcoming otherwise it could be a sort of bother for the Royals.
